1. Which paracetamol would take the longest time to dissolve? Explain why


State how these changes the rate of a chemical reaction
2 a) decreasing the temperature of the reaction
B) decreasing the particle size of reactants
C) decreasing the concentration of reactants

1. The paracetamol would take the longest time to dissolve in Expt. A.

Decreasing the temperature and the surface area of the solid decreases its rate of solution.

2. (a) Decreasing the temperature decreases the rate of a reaction because  the particles are moving more slowly, so

• there are fewer collisions per second

• there is less energy per collision and fewer collisions will have enough energy for a reaction to occur.

2. (b) Decreasing the particle size of reactants increases the rate  of a reaction because the surface area increases, making more particles available for reaction.

2. (c) Decreasing the concentration of reactants decreases the rate of reaction because fewer particles are available to collide. The reaction is slower if there are fewer collisions per second.
